Vereinfachen Sie die API-Antwortnutzlast auf ein 2D-Array mit standardisierten Schlüsseln der zweiten Ebene

Post a reply

Smilies
:) :( :oops: :chelo: :roll: :wink: :muza: :sorry: :angel: :read: *x) :clever:
View more smilies

BBCode is ON
[img] is ON
[flash] is OFF
[url] is ON
Smilies are ON

Topic review
   

Expand view Topic review: Vereinfachen Sie die API-Antwortnutzlast auf ein 2D-Array mit standardisierten Schlüsseln der zweiten Ebene

by Guest » 16 Jan 2025, 04:51

Ich habe Probleme mit der Handhabung eines verschachtelten Arrays, das ich als Ergebnis einer API erhalte. Print_r($result, true); gibt ein Array zurück, das so aussieht (nur viel länger):

Code: Select all

Array
(
[success] => 1
[return] => Array
(
[sellorders] => Array
(
[0] => Array
(
[sellprice] => 0.00000059
[quantity] => 1076.00000000
[total] => 0.00063484
)

[1] => Array
(
[sellprice] => 0.00000060
[quantity] => 927.41519000
[total] => 0.00055645
)
)

[buyorders] => Array
(
[0] => Array
(
[buyprice] => 0.00000058
[quantity] => 6535.77328102
[total] => 0.00379075
)

[1] => Array
(
[buyprice] => 0.00000057
[quantity] => 118539.39620414
[total] => 0.06756746
)
)

)

)
Ich muss die 3 Werte (Verkaufspreis/Kaufpreis, Menge, Gesamt) aus dem ersten Index beider Arrays (Verkaufsaufträge und Kaufaufträge) abrufen und sie in Variablen speichern ($Verkaufspreis, $Verkaufsmenge). , $selltotal).
Das vollständige Beispiel-PHP-Skript, das ich verwende, finden Sie unten auf dieser Seite.

Top